Since its beginnings as a cobbler's in 1936, the company has achieved a level that lies somewhere between artisanry and art.

Hagop Baltayan arrived in France following the Armenian Genocide of 1915. Self-taught, he created a range of extremely comfortable cycling shoes.

Jean Baltayan, who trained as a shoemaker, took up the reins in 1966, during the rise of ready-to-wear. He wisely chose to continue the shoe repair business, increasing the quality of his services. He created innovative techniques combining shoemaking and shoe repair.

Jean-Christophe Baltayan and the creation of a world of footwear. Awarded the title 'Best Shoemaker in France' in 1999, he filed various patents and techniques, offered excellent materials with 100% vegetable-tanned leather, and diversified with unique care products awarded for their quality.

From repairing shoes to fine shoemaking: the shoes are made using first class techniques and materials, in accordance with standards that have lasted for centuries, in order to achieve superb comfort. You don't necessarily need to have tailored shoes for a comfortable fit. The comfort that his grandfather's business was built on remains the challenge today. This is reflected in the assembly: Hypoallergenic sock lining, Alcantara© lining, heel height and instep. A card guarantees the soles for life and a secret formula, one of the components of which is gold, covers their entire surface.
